How Is Custody Handled in an Unregistered Marriage in Jordan?

Custody in an unregistered marriage in Jordan, the requirement to prove the marriage first, and the effect on children's rights.

This page addresses: Custody in an Unregistered Marriage. In general, In an unregistered marriage in Jordan, the marriage must be proven before the Sharia Court before custody of the children can be decided. Non-registration does not forfeit the children's rights, but it complicates the procedure. However, the legal answer must be read together with the relevant statutory provisions and the facts of the case.

The main legal basis is the Jordanian Personal Status Law. Relevant article references include Articles 170-186, 170, 171, 172, 174. The answer should be read with those provisions and with the facts of the specific case, not as a guaranteed outcome.

In custody matters, the child’s best interest remains central, while the statutory order of custodians and the custodian’s conditions must be respected. Custody does not transfer merely by allegation; it depends on legal conditions, evidence, and court assessment.

This issue may depend on the facts, evidence, and the court’s assessment, so the general rule should be applied carefully.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does proving the marriage for custody take?
From 6 months to a year depending on evidence. The stronger the evidence (witnesses, customary documents), the faster the process.
Can the custodian claim provisional maintenance before proving the marriage?
Yes in exceptional cases, especially if the children suffer neglect. The court has authority for interim orders to protect children.
Do children lose inheritance rights in unregistered marriages?
No, if the marriage is proven (even retroactively after the father's death). Children gain full rights including inheritance.
